Bournemouth Preview – Can Cherries bounce back?
Bournemouth will head into this Saturday’s lunchtime clash against fellow play-off hopefuls, Watford, having suffered back-to-back defeats against QPR and Cardiff City which has resulted in Bournemouth dropping out of the top six in the Championship.
Results overall have nose-dived for The Cherries who have managed to record just two wins out of their last 10 matches which came in the shape of wins over Birmingham City and Rotherham United, but the six defeats within this period have taken their toll.
Nevertheless, Bournemouth still hold a reasonable record at home of 9-3-4 27/16 but they’re up against a Watford side who are pushing for automatic promotion; the goals market maybe best here as nine of Bournemouth’s 16 home matches have seen under 2.5 goals.
Watford Preview – Can Watford win five on trot?
Watford have won their last four matches on the trot in the Championship and it’s this sort of form which has once again thrust The Hornets into contention for automatic promotion following wins against Bristol City, Preston NE, Derby County and Blackburn Rovers respectively.
The visitors have hit form at just about the right time as they’ve suffered just one defeat from their last 10 matches overall which was a 2-1 loss to QPR but they’re unbeaten in their last five matches away from home.
Watford’s away record though doesn’t look entirely convincing as it stands at 5-7-4 11/11 while there’s also been a distinct lack of goals on the road for the visitors as 13 of Watford’s 16 away matches have also resulted in under 2.5 goals.
